Transaction 51a5133a2b978e3df2484766d3f82db6f092bb7fefdfe8ecb7d205f24f89d082
1 Input
1 Output
-
51a5133a2b978e3df2484766d3f82db6f092bb7fefdfe8ecb7d205f24f89d082:0
- value
- 20516
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2102d00cfc9961cb825a2738270ba34026946d9f22fa3526fbb05b037f9c105
- address
- bc1p7ggz6qx0extpewp95fecyu96xspxj3ke7gh6x5n0hvzmqdlecyzsu4sxtr